  14. I started this quite a while ago and it became quite a project. I de-radiused the wheel wells, removed the vent window frame from the a-pillar, and I trimmed out the parking lights from the front bumper. The grill was painted with a light coat of argent silver to mimick the anodized aluminum grill. The chassis is AMT Thunderbird, actually two of them because I had to length in it. The interior consists of modified pieces from the Thunderbird. The engine came from the Thunderbird also with an air cleaner from the Johan '72 Torino stocker. My big dillema was paint, after looking at a lot of stock car pics I noticed there were not many green cars, so the green went on and I added the gold because I liked the looks of the Holman and Moody 68 Torino's.
